Sandy Hill is an unincorporated community in Washington County, Texas, United States.
Near Little Rocky Creek on Hardeman Branch is a hill with a 343 ft (105 m) elevation.
German immigrants established the settlement, which grew in the early part of the 20th century.
Sandy Hill's population increased from a low of ten during the Great Depression to an estimated fifty by 1945 and maintained that figure through 2000.
[2] Today, the community is served by the Brenham Independent School District.
